Output 93dc57456331d28a4d55d490e5d23b3caf701968272f859df85bbbd811418383:1

value
753288734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ac5e8b8a223c175f1adef5c73d94b56d0c53761 OP_EQUAL
address
348aaVdSz28A3G8i3DTTCha1h87vBTYPkm
transaction
93dc57456331d28a4d55d490e5d23b3caf701968272f859df85bbbd811418383
spent
true